Who is Tucker Carlson's Wife?

Tucker Carlson is married to Susan Andrews, a woman who has largely remained out of the public eye despite her husband's fame. The couple has known each other since high school, showcasing a long-lasting relationship that has withstood the pressures of public scrutiny. Their strong bond is evident in their family life, where they are parents to four children.

A Glimpse into Susan Andrews's Background

Susan Andrews was born in 1969, and she grew up in the affluent suburb of La Jolla, California. She comes from a well-educated family, with her father serving as the headmaster of the prestigious St. George's School in Rhode Island.
